Commuting Perturbations Of Operator Equations, Xue Xu, Jiu Ding
Faculty Publications
Let X be a Banach space and let T: X →X be a bounded linear operator with closed range. We study a class of commuting perturbations of the corresponding operator equation, using the concept of the spectral radius of a bounded linear operator. Our results extend the classic perturbation theorem for invertible operators and its generalization for arbitrary operators under the commutability assumption.

Fitting Parameter Uncertainties In Least Squares Fitting, R. Steven Turley
Faculty Publications
This article review the theory and practice of computing uncertainties in the fit parameters in least squares fits. It shows how to estimate the uncertainties and gives some numerical examples in Julia of their use. Examples are given and validated for both linear and nonlinear fits.

Polynomial Fitting, R. Steven Turley
Faculty Publications
This article reviews the theory and some good practice for fitting polynomials to data. I show by theory and example why fitting using a basis of orthogonal polynomials rather than monomials is desirable. I also show how to scale the independent variable for a more stable fit. I also demonstrate how to compute the uncertainty in the fit parameters. Finally, I discuss regression analysis: how to determine whether adding an additional term to the fit is justified.

Perturbation Results For Projecting A Point Onto A Linear Manifold, Jiu Ding
Faculty Publications
Some new results will be presented on the perturbation analysis for the orthogonal projection of a point onto a linear manifold. The obtained perturbation upper bound is with respect to the distance from the perturbed solution to the unperturbed manifold.
